body {background: url(/files/siteImage2/bg_side.gif) 50%;}
#bodyDiv {background: url(/files/siteImage2/bg_top_grey.gif) no-repeat top 50%;}
.cellborders td {border-right:1px solid #000000; border-bottom:1px solid #000000;}
.orangeBox {width:120px; height:25px; background:#FF9900; border: 1px solid #000000; padding:3px;}
.orangeBox a,.orangeBox a:visited, .orangeBox a:hover {color:white; font-weight:bold; text-decoration:none;}
#page {background: #FFFFFF url(/files/siteImage2/bund_bg.gif) bottom left no-repeat; border-right:6px solid #FFFFFF; border-left:1px solid #FFFFFF;}
#contentMargin img {height:500px; width:1px;}
.eventHeaderRow td {border-bottom:1px solid #000000;}
input, select, textarea, buttom {font-family:verdana; font-size:11px;}
.borderBottomTop {border-bottom:1px solid #000000; border-top:1px solid #000000; background:#F5F5F5;}
#rightDiv {background:#CEF0FF url(/files/siteImage2/right_bottom.gif) no-repeat bottom; padding:0px 0px 121px 0px;}
#pc a, #pc a:visited, #pc a:hover {font-weight:bold;}

/*templates*/
#normalPageRight #bigHeader, #pageNameDiv {font-size:35px; font-weight:bold; font-family:arial; color:#FFFFFF; text-transform:uppercase;}
#pageNameDiv {background:#96AEC8; height:45px; width:auto; padding:8px 0px 0px 10px; font-size:25px;}

#titleBar {background:url(/files/siteImage2/titleBar_bg.gif) no-repeat; margin-top:1px; padding-top:8px; padding-left:15px; font-size:35px; font-weight:bold; font-family:arial; color:#A4DAF2;}
#historyline, #historyline a.historyLine, #historyline a.historyLine:visited, #historyline a.historyLine:hover {font-size:10px; color:white; text-decoration:none; text-transform:none; font-family:verdana;}
#loginBox {}

/*MENU*/
#menu {width:760px; height:19px; border:0px;}
#nav li {width:auto; margin: 0px 0px 0px 5px;}
#nav li a {text-align:center; padding:2px 2px 2px 15px;}
#nav a.activeMenu, #nav a.activeMenu:hover, #nav a.menu:hover {background:#FFFFFF url(/files/siteImage2/menu_active_bg.gif) no-repeat left center; color:#000000;}

/*UMENU*/
#submenuDiv {background:#A3B3CC url(/files/siteImage2/umenu_bottom.gif) no-repeat bottom; padding:10px 0px 55px 0px;}
#submenuNav img {display:none;}
#submenuNav , #submenuNav ul {margin:0px; padding:0px; list-style-type:none; lis-style:none;}
#submenuNav li {width:140px; display:block; list-style-type:none; line-height:22px; padding:0px; margin:0px;}
#submenuNav ul li {line-height:14px; width:140px; display:block; padding:0px;}

#submenuNav a {display:block; padding: 0px 0px 0px 5px; margin:0px;}
#submenuNav a.umenu:hover {background:#C6CFE0; color:#333333;}
#submenuNav li a.activeMenu {background:#2C4D83; border-bottom:1px solid white;}
#submenuNav li li a {background:#C6CFE0; padding: 0px 0px 5px 15px; font-weight:normal;}
#submenuNav li li a.activeMenu {background:#9EA6B4; font-weight:bold;}
#submenuNav li li a.umenu:hover {background:#AAB3C2; color:white;}


/*CALENDAR*/
#calendarTable {background:#FFFFFF; border-left:1px solid #CCCCCC;}
#calendarTable td {border:0px; border-bottom:1px solid #CCCCCC; border-right:1px solid #CCCCCC;height:22px;width:26px;}
#calendarTable .normalday a, #calendarTable .normalday a:visited, #calendarTable .normalday a:hover, #calendarTable .sunday a, #calendarTable .sunday a:visited, #calendarTable .sunday a:hover {font-weight:normal; text-decoration:none;}
.today, .activeday {border:1px solid black; text-decoration:none;}
.normalday{background:#E5E5E5;}
.activeday {background:url(/files/siteImage2/blue_bg.gif);}
.activeday a:link,.activeday a:visited,.activeday a:hover {font-weight:bold; color:white; text-decoration:none;}
.sunday{color:#FFFFFF;background:#CCCCCC; text-decaration:none;}
.calendartop {color:white; font-weight:bold;}
.weekNumber {color:#999999;}

/*GALLERY*/
.galleryTable {margin-top:20px; margin-bottom:20px;}
.galleryTable td {padding:5px;}
.galleryCell {width:25%; border:1px solid #000000; text-align:center;}

/*PROJECTDATABASEN*/
#menuCell {background: url(/files/siteImage2/menu_bg.gif);border:1px solid #000000;cursor:pointer; font-size:11px; font-family:verdana; color:white; font-weight:bold;}

/*OBJECT CELL*/
.funcHeaderCell {color:#2C4D83; height:25px; font-weight:bold; padding:4px; border-bottom:2px solid #FFFFFF; text-align:center; font-size:14px; background:#CCCCCC;}
.funcContentCell {padding:7px;}
.funcArchivCell {border-top:1px solid #FFFFFF; border-bottom:1px solid #FFFFFF; background:#C6CFE0; padding:4px;}
.smallDate {font-size:10px; color:#666666;}

/*Nyhedsmail*/
   .Broedtekst {font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 11px;
color: #000000;}
   .Overskrift {font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 12px;
font-weight: bold;
color: #ff9900;}
   .KategoriOverskrift {font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 14px;
font-weight: bold;
color: #0097D7;}
   .Titel_og_dato {color: #FFFFFF;
font-weight: bold;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 12px;}


/*FORUM*/
.forumDetail {width:100%}
.forumHeader {font-weight:bold; text-transform:uppercase; background:#F5F5F5;}
.topSubject {font-weight:bold; background:#96AEC8;}
.forumTop {width:100%; border-bottom:1px solid #CCCCCC; background:#ffffff;}
